The Do You Have The GUTZ to stop domestic violence race helps raise funds for Domestic Violence Awareness through the North Alabama Crisis Services. It also promotes health awareness and physical fitness for the Greater Metropolitan Huntsville community. The funds from the 5K will provide scholarships for deserving High School Seniors throughout Madison and Limestone Counties.

This race is being presented to you by the Youth Friendship Foundation of the Psi Kappa Kappa chapter of Omega Psi Phi fraternity INC. The Y.O.U.T.H. Friendship Foundation was formed as a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ization to fund and develop integrated comprehensive youth enrichment programs focused on education, character and leadership development for the youth in Madison and Limestone counties.
